A numerical study of unwanted oscillations occurring due to interaction of the annular helical electron beam with azimuthally symmetric TE0, n modes in the absorbing section of a gyrotron is performed using the BOR FDTD — particle-in-cell (PIC) code newly developed at IHM. Strong dependence of the appearance of the parasitic interaction and its amplitude on the spread of the pitch factor of quasi particles is observed.
